98 Now, since the sum of the squares on AG, GB, that is, CL, is medial, while twice the rectangle AG, GB, that is, FL, is rational, therefore CL is incommensurable with FL.
98 But, as CL is to FL, so is CM to FM; [VI. 1] therefore CM is incommensurable in length with FM. [X. 11]
98 And both are rational; therefore CM, MF are rational straight lines commensurable in square only; therefore CF is an apotome. [X. 73]
98 I say next that it is also a second apotome.
98 For let FM be bisected at N, and let NO be drawn through N parallel to CD; therefore each of the rectangles FO, NL is equal to the rectangle AG, GB.
98 Now, since the rectangle AG, GB is a mean proportional between the squares on AG, GB, and the square on AG is equal to CH, the rectangle AG, GB to NL, and the square on BG to KL, therefore NL is also a mean proportional between CH, KL; therefore, as CH is to NL, so is NL to KL.
98 But, as CH is to NL, so is CK to NM, and, as NL is to KL, so is NM to MK; [VI. 1] therefore, as CK is to NM, so is NM, so is KM; [V. 11] therefore the rectangle CK, KM is equal to the square on NM [VI. 17], that is, to the fourth part of the square on FM.
98 Since the CM, MF are two unequal straight lines, and the rectangle CK, KM equal to the fourth part of the square on MF and deficient by a square figure has been applied to the greater, CM, and divides it into commensurable parts, therefore the square on CM is greater than the square on MF by the square on a straight line commensurable in length with CM. [X. 17]
98 And the annex FM is commensurable in length with the rational straight line CD set out; therefore CF is a second apotome. [X. Deff. III. 2]
98 Therefore etc. Q. E. D.

PROPOSITION 99.

99 The square on a second apotome of a medial straight line applied to a rational straight line produces as breadth a third apotome.
99 Let AB be a second apotome of a medial straight line, and CD rational, and to CD let there be applied CE equal to the square on AB, producing CF as breadth; I say that CF is a third apotome.
